I picked up a used '08 WRR a couple months ago, and am thankful to have this forum, as well as the depth of information on ADVRider. It's made maintenance easier, and it is interesting to read about the mods other folks have done. If I figure out how to post a picture, I'll show off the homemade rear rack, side pannier guards, and HIGHWAY PEGS Greetings from Mendocino 379944 My new minimalist tourer!

It has been a great errand runner and a true dirt bike with license plate. I've ridden single track with the best off-road guys at Cow Mtn. and the bike will handle way more than this rider. Greetings from Mendocino 93746 I did the Yamaha lowering of the seat, but would like it another inch or so lower. Other than that, no mods in the future.
